The problem

Why this needed to exist.

Small everyday actions—checking system health, opening a work setup, recovering copied text, starting a timer, or capturing the screen—are scattered across separate windows and menu-bar utilities. The result is constant context switching for things that should take one gesture.

How it works

One focused system, built around the job.

SuperNotch is a native macOS utility that turns unused space around the camera notch into a compact home for everyday actions and live information. It expands when you need it, keeps tools one gesture away, then folds back into the top edge of the display instead of becoming another window to manage.

The notch is fixed hardware. SuperNotch treats the space around it as useful interface instead of dead area.

Capabilities

What it does today.

  • A two-stage spring animation that grows naturally from the hardware notch
  • Focus workspaces that open groups of apps for work, code, web, or chat
  • Clipboard history, reusable snippets, tasks, countdowns, and Pomodoro sessions
  • Area, window, and full-screen capture plus quick screen recording
  • At-a-glance CPU, memory, battery, storage, network, weather, and world clocks
  • Media controls, file shelf, calendar, shortcuts, mirror, spaces, and app tracking
  • Multi-display support, a floating mode for notchless Macs, gestures, and haptics
